- [ ] Queue-depth autoscaler (Hoppervane): confirm scale-up threshold still matches the broker's actual lag metric, not the stale gauge we deprecated last quarter. Check cooldown isn't fighting the cron burst at 02:00 — it's bitten us before. Kick the staging queue with the loadgen script and watch replicas settle. If anything looks off, don't guess; flag it straight to the autoscaler owner.

account owner for bawip-tahag: Raleth Quenok

- [ ] Step 7: Archive cold storage buckets (Glacierline tier). Confirm both ceremony witnesses are present, verify bucket manifests match the Oxbow ledger, then seal the archive key shares. Plugin authors may observe but not handle shares. Once sealed, the archive index itself is encrypted and can only be reopened with the passphrase below.

vault phrase of badup-hahig = tamael-aldael-kelmir-istael-fenok-istwyn-tamius-jorath-oliion

## Service Account: Partner SFTP Drop (Fernbright)

The Fernbright partner drop is polled every 15 minutes by the ingest-relay service account. Files land in the inbound bucket and are checksummed before parsing. The account was re-provisioned this sprint after the old one hit its expiry window. For the sync notes, the new key used by ingest-relay is as follows.

gateway credential: kto23_dolYgAScEh2TaPOlStqOl98

Subject: Handover — DedupeHorn on-call alert deduplicator

Hi Marit,

Taking over DedupeHorn this week. For plugin authors: dedup keys are computed from alert source, fingerprint, and a 10-minute bucket, so plugins must not mutate fingerprints after ingestion. Suppressed alerts are retained for 30 days for audit. State lives in the shared dedup database; plugins connect read-only using the connection string below.

database URL for yagaf-bawig: postgresql://briax_svc:80@db-4189.torvasys.test:5432/lamion